Expanding Therapeutic Applications of Mildronate Dihydricum in Sports Science

Mildronate dihydricum, also known as meldonium, has garnered significant attention in the realm of sports science due to its unique pharmacological properties. Originally developed to treat heart conditions, its applications have evolved, presenting promising benefits for athletes and active individuals seeking to enhance their performance and recovery.

1. The Mechanism of Action

Mildronate functions by inhibiting the synthesis of carnitine, a compound pivotal for fat metabolism. This leads to an energy shift from fatty acid oxidation to glucose metabolism, providing a more efficient energy source during physical exertion. The key aspects of its mechanism include:

  1. Improved endurance by delaying fatigue
  2. Enhanced recovery rates through reduced muscle damage
  3. Increased overall physical performance
